Signing up to buy $1000 visa/mc gift cards
You can buy the $1000 cards on Simon's volume site. Their regular site only sells $500 cards.
If you're new, or haven't bought anything in a year, you need to register at https://www.simon.com/volume/register-consumer
As part of the registration process, you will have to go to a brick and mortar mall and buy at least $3000 in cards in person, as well as filling out some paperwork while there. After that, you can do everything online.

As of Nov 2020, Simon Mall Gift cards will only work for $99/swipe for money services at Walmart and many grocery chains.

$1000 gift cards are available indefinitely.

Originally Posted by radonc1
Multiple DPs exist that says Amex Business cards are good to go. It seems to now have a DP that is contrary to that but many DPs are later than your test charge.

I cannot explain the discrepancy.
AFAIK, all AmEx business cards stopped paying out any MRs or cashback on Simon Visa cards beginning last April. That includes purchases of the cards in malls, the online retail site run through giftcardmall.com, and the Simon corporate volume site. (Same goes for AmEx retail cards too.)

Perhaps you could link to those DPs that say otherwise, or at least tell us where you saw them.
